办公小浣熊
Raccoon - AI 智能助手

知识库检索如何支持公式查询?

想象一下,你正在撰写一篇关于量子力学的论文,需要查找一个关键的物理公式,或者你是一名工程师,需要快速比对不同材料属性的计算公式。传统的关键词搜索,比如输入“质能方程”,或许能找到一些相关文档,但如果你想找出所有使用了特定积分符号或具有相似数学结构的公式,恐怕就力不从心了。这正是知识库检索支持公式查询所要解决的核心难题——让机器理解并检索人类智慧的精确结晶:数学公式。

随着数字化学习的深入,知识库中积累的包含公式的文档数量激增,从学术论文到技术手册,公式无处不在。如何高效、精准地从海量信息中定位到所需的数学表达式,已成为提升学习和工作效率的关键。这不仅关乎检索技术的革新,更关乎我们能否更便捷地触碰和传承人类的知识财富。小浣熊AI助手在构建其智能知识库时,深刻认识到这一需求,并致力于让公式检索像文本搜索一样自然流畅。

一、 公式识别的核心技术

要实现公式查询,第一步是让知识库“看得懂”公式。这并非易事,因为公式不仅仅是文字,更是二维的、具有复杂空间结构的符号集合。目前,主流技术路径主要依赖于两大支柱:光学字符识别(OCR)的进阶版——公式识别,以及对文档源文件(如LaTeX)的深度解析。

对于存量的大量扫描版PDF或图片格式的文档,公式识别技术显得尤为重要。先进的公式识别引擎不仅能识别单个字符,更能理解字符间的空间位置关系,比如上标、下标、分式结构、根号范围等,并将其转化为标准的线性格式,如LaTeX代码。这就好比给一张公式图片配上了一套机器可以理解的“字幕”。小浣熊AI助手在处理此类文档时,会优先运用高效的公式识别模型,将图像公式数字化,为后续的索引和检索打下坚实基础。

另一方面,对于原生数字文档(如由LaTeX编译生成的PDF或Word文档),情况则乐观许多。这些文件通常内嵌了公式的源代码(如LaTeX码)或结构化信息(如MathML)。直接提取这些结构化信息,其准确率远高于图像识别。研究者指出,利用文档的底层结构信息进行公式检索,是目前最高效、最准确的方法之一。小浣熊AI助手能够智能识别文档类型,优先提取高质量的结构化公式数据,确保检索源的准确性。

二、 公式的索引与表示

识别出公式并将其转化为代码后,下一步是如何对这些公式建立索引,以便快速查询。直接存储原始的LaTeX字符串并进行字符串匹配是一种简单方法,但这种方法非常脆弱,无法处理语义相同但写法略有差异的公式。因此,更先进的方法是寻找能够表征公式语义的“指纹”。

一种强大的方法是基于符号树(Symbol Tree)运算符树(Operator Tree)的索引技术。每个公式都可以被解析成一棵树状结构,树根是主要的运算符(如等号、积分号),枝叶则是变量、数字等操作数。通过比较两棵树的相似度,就能判断两个公式在结构上的相似性。例如,E = mc²能量 = 质量 × 光速平方 尽管文本形式不同,但其背后的符号树结构是相似的。小浣熊AI助手利用此类技术,能够理解公式的深层逻辑,而非停留在表面文字。

另一种前沿的探索是公式嵌入(Formula Embedding),其灵感来自于自然语言处理中的词向量技术。目标是将一个公式映射到一个高维向量空间中的一个点,语义相近的公式在这个空间中的位置也彼此接近。例如,所有描述“勾股定理”的变体在向量空间中会聚集在一起。这种方法为实现“模糊匹配”和“语义搜索”提供了可能。尽管这项技术仍处于发展阶段,但它代表了公式检索的未来方向。小浣熊AI助手的研究团队也正积极探索此类前沿算法,以不断提升检索的智能化水平。

三、 多样化的查询方式

一个优秀的公式检索系统,应该支持多种符合用户习惯的查询方式,降低使用门槛。并非所有用户都是LaTeX专家,因此提供直观的输入接口至关重要。

1. 自然语言描述查询: 这是最用户友好的方式。用户可以直接输入“求三角形面积的公式”或“正弦定理是什么”,系统通过自然语言处理技术理解用户意图,然后从知识库中返回最相关的公式。小浣熊AI助手增强了对其上下文的理解能力,能够将模糊的自然语言请求准确地映射到具体的数学概念上。

2. 手绘公式输入: 对于移动设备或触屏用户,手绘输入极其方便。用户在屏幕上画出公式草图,系统通过手写识别技术将其转换为标准格式并进行检索。这种方式尤其适合在灵感迸发时快速记录和查找数学思想。

3. 示例公式查询(Query by Example): 这是非常强大和精准的查询方式。用户提供一个公式作为例子(可以是图片、LaTeX代码或甚至从其他文档中复制粘贴),系统会在知识库中寻找结构相同或相似的公式。例如,用户提供一个简单的积分式,系统可以找到所有含有该积分结构的复杂公式。以下表格对比了不同查询方式的特点:

查询方式 优点 适用场景
自然语言描述 直观、无需专业知识 概念性查询、初学者使用
手绘输入 便捷、符合自然习惯 移动端快速查询、思路记录
示例公式 精准、结构匹配度高 科研、工程中的精密比对
LaTeX代码输入 精确、无歧义 专业人士、已有明确目标公式

四、 检索结果的应用价值

精准的公式检索本身不是目的,其价值体现在对用户学习和工作的实际赋能上。它能带来的好处远超简单的“找到公式”。

首先,它极大地提升了知识发现的效率。研究者可以快速追溯一个公式在不同文献中的演变和应用,学生可以轻松找到解决特定问题所需的所有相关公式,避免了在成堆的文档中手动翻阅的繁琐。小浣熊AI助手的目标正是成为用户的知识杠杆,用技术力量撬动信息的冰山。

其次,它支持深度关联与推理。当系统找到一个公式时,它不仅可以展示公式本身,还能关联出:

  • 使用该公式的完整文档或章节。
  • 该公式的推导过程或证明。
  • 基于该公式的具体应用实例和习题。
  • 与该公式相关的其他公式或概念(如逆定理、推广形式等)。

这种立体的知识网络,将一个孤立的公式变成了一个鲜活知识体系的入口,促进了更深层次的理解和创新。

五、 面临的挑战与未来方向

尽管公式检索技术取得了长足进步,但仍面临一些挑战。首先是准确性与复杂性的平衡。非常复杂、不规范的公式(尤其在古老的手写文献中)的识别率仍有待提升。其次是对公式语义的深层理解,目前的系统在理解公式的物理意义或数学背景方面仍有局限,例如,它可能知道一个公式描述的是“波动”,但很难区分是声波还是光波。

未来的研究方向可能集中在:

  • 结合上下文理解:将公式与其周围的文本、图表结合起来进行一体化分析和检索,真正理解公式在具体语境中的含义。
  • 跨模态检索:实现文本、公式、图表、甚至语音之间的无缝互查。例如,用一段语音描述来查找公式,或者通过公式来查找相关的数据图表。
  • 个性化与推荐:根据用户的知识背景和检索历史,智能推荐可能感兴趣的相关公式和知识,实现真正的个性化知识服务。

小浣熊AI助手也将持续关注这些前沿动向,并计划在未来版本中集成更智能的上下文分析和跨模态检索能力,让知识获取的体验更加丝滑和强大。

回顾全文,知识库检索支持公式查询是一项融合了模式识别、自然语言处理、数据库技术等多种前沿科技的复杂工程。它通过精准的识别、智能的索引、多样的查询和深度的关联,彻底改变了我们与公式化知识互动的方式。从核心技术的突破到应用场景的深化,这一领域正朝着更智能、更人性化的方向飞速发展。

其重要性不言而喻,它不仅是学术研究的加速器,也是教育培训和工程技术领域的效率引擎。作为专注于提升知识获取体验的小浣熊AI助手,我们坚信,打破公式检索的壁垒,就是为每一位求知者打开一扇通往更广阔知识世界的大门。建议用户在实际使用中,多尝试不同的查询方式,并结合小浣熊AI助手提供的上下文信息,以获得最佳的知识探索体验。未来的道路充满挑战,但也充满无限可能。

小浣熊家族 Raccoon - AI 智能助手 - 商汤科技

办公小浣熊是商汤科技推出的AI办公助手,办公小浣熊2.0版本全新升级

代码小浣熊办公小浣熊